Yaxchilan weaves through to score for O'Leary

Ger O’Leary’s Yaxchilan burst through inside the final furlong to land the spoils in the See You Next Friday Handicap at Fairyhouse.

Dylan Browne McMonagle held his mount up in the six furlong contest and he had plenty to do turning for home.

The 12/1 shot weaved his way into contention passing the furlong pole and got his head in front in the final 100 yards to record a half-length success over Livingston Range

It was a first career success for the Mehmas gelding, who was making his fourth start for O’Leary.

O’Leary said:- “Dylan did a wonderful job getting him out of traffic and said he probably needs seven (furlongs).

“Dropping into the 0-60 was a big help so we’ll look for something similar over the next three weeks, but Dylan was the architect of that.”

About Gary Carson
Gary started out as a trainee/assistant journalist with the Sporting Life newspaper and has worked in the racing industry for over 25 years. He has been with the Press Association since 2013 and won the Irish Field Nap Table in 2016. He enjoys working with horses and trained his own horse, Mamaslittlestar, to win a point-to-point in 2019.
